Digital Account Director

Job LocationStoke Holy Cross
EducationNot Mentioned
SalaryCompetitive salary
IndustryNot Mentioned
Functional AreaNot Mentioned
Job TypePermanent , full-time

Job Description

My client is excited to invite a talented Digital Account Director to enhance their senior team. You will play a pivotal role in leading, managing, and growing a range of specified client accounts, contributing to new business development, and supportingthe agencys growth. Is this youAs a dynamic and thriving integrated marketing agency, renowned for their expertise in the field, they pride themselves on their team of passionate, dedicated, and forward-thinking marketing professionals dedicated to delivering outstanding results for theirwell-known clients.Key Responsibilities:

  • Devise and communicate digital marketing strategies to clients.
  • Manage key digital accounts, serving as the primary client contact.
  • Setup and manage paid marketing campaigns, including Google Ads and social media ads.
  • Develop and implement long-term SEO strategies, including SEO audits and adapting to changes in search engine algorithms and user behaviour.
  • Analyse digital audit findings, making prioritised recommendations.
  • Participate in client reporting on a weekly and monthly basis.
  • Build excellent client relationships, identifying mutually beneficial opportunities.
  • Assist the Head of Digital in reviewing digital outputs.
  • Support and train team members.
Your Skills:
  • Strong history of agency experience.
  • Exceptional communication skills.
  • Strong understanding of organic and paid media principles is ideal.
  • Proven track record in managing successful integrated digital marketing campaigns.
  • Experience with WordPress CMS, and ideally Umbraco.
  • Proficiency in GA4, Google Tag Manager, and data analysis.
  • Google Ads certification.
Benefits:
  • Competitive salary.
  • 23 days holiday plus bank holidays, increasing with service.
  • Birthday holiday allowance.
  • Profit share bonus scheme.
  • Company pension.
  • Flexible and remote working options.
  • Annual team away day and regular socials.
  • Commitment to team wellbeing, including an Employee Assistance Program.
  • Training and development budgets.
  • Free on-site parking.
